Nuevos endpoints
Ledger Settings
Dos nuevos endpoints te permiten gestionar las reglas de validación por Ledger vía la API:- Obtener Ledger Settings —
GET /organizations/{id}/ledgers/{id}/settings - Actualizar Ledger Settings —
PATCH /organizations/{id}/ledgers/{id}/settings
Balance History
Dos nuevos endpoints soportan consultas de saldo en un punto en el tiempo para auditoría, reconciliación y reportes históricos:- Obtener Balance History — obtener el estado de un saldo específico en un timestamp dado.
- Obtener Balance History por cuenta — obtener el estado de todos los saldos de una cuenta en un timestamp dado.
Esquemas actualizados
Transaction Routing
- Las Operation Routes ahora incluyen
accountingEntriesy soportan un tipo de rutabidirectional - Las Transaction Routes usan un nuevo formato de objeto
operationRoutes - Las Operations incluyen nuevos campos:
direction,routeIdyrouteCode
Nuevos filtros de consulta
| Endpoint | Nuevos filtros |
|---|---|
| List Organizations | legal_name, doing_business_as |
| List Ledgers | name |
| List Operations | direction, route_id |
Nuevos códigos de error
Los códigos de error 0140–0158 fueron agregados a la referencia de errores, cubriendo fallos de validación para las nuevas funcionalidades de Ledger Settings y routing.
Alineación de la especificación OpenAPI
Todas las especificaciones OpenAPI publicadas se alinearon con las versiones reales del código fuente:
| Spec | Actualizado a |
|---|---|
| Ledger | v3.5.0 |
| CRM | última estable |
| Fees Engine | última estable |
| Access Manager | última estable |

